Output 66a54820ee6f004fd8904a44241887e45eb296e28e77ad592a3dbd9ed8664bb6:13

value
108479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e511b968c81af4388eaf60186f1bb87ab1dfaa3 OP_EQUAL
address
38q7nyP6FG15U3WgXNUfAjAhVo2WL6tE5Q
transaction
66a54820ee6f004fd8904a44241887e45eb296e28e77ad592a3dbd9ed8664bb6
confirmations
302141
spent
true